Specifications
Operating Temperature: -40°C ~ 105°C
Package / Case: Radial, Can - Snap-In
Mounting Type: Through Hole
Surface Mount Land Size: --
Height - Seated (Max): 1.063" (27.00mm)
Size / Dimension: 1.378" Dia (35.00mm)
Lead Spacing: 0.394" (10.00mm)
Applications: General Purpose
Ratings: --
Polarization: Polar
Series: MXG
Lifetime @ Temp.: 3000 Hrs @ 105°C
ESR (Equivalent Series Resistance): --
Voltage - Rated: 50V
Tolerance: ±20%
Capacitance: 4700µF
Moisture Sensitivity Level (MSL): --
Part Status: Active
Lead Free Status / RoHS Status: --
Packaging: Bulk

Aluminum electrolytic capacitors, or simply electrolytic capacitors, are electronic components with a wide range of practical applications. The 50MXG4700MEFCSN35X25 belongs to this type of capacitors. It is a nonlinear polarized electrolytic capacitor with a dielectric oxide film, aluminum electrodes, and a sealant envelope. It is used in a wide range of electronic circuits.

Applications

50MXG4700MEFCSN35X25 aluminum electrolytic capacitors are designed for a variety of applications, including audio/visual devices, power supplies, power conditioning, computer motherboards, and other industrial applications. It can also be used in automotive and other transportation systems, communications systems, uninterruptible power supply (UPS) systems, and solar energy applications. Its excellent electrical characteristics make it suitable for a variety of high-temperature and high-voltage applications.
